Game Over: $32K Crypto Heist Hits Cancer Patient via Steam’s Block Blasters!

A gamer lost $32,000 to a cryptodrainer hidden in Block Blasters, a verified Steam game. This retro 2D platformer turned wallet thief during a live fundraising event. If you downloaded Block Blasters, change your passwords and secure your wallets now. Steam’s been a hotbed for malware lately, so play safe and stay vigilant!

Key Points:

  • Block Blasters on Steam turned into a cryptodrainer after being compromised.
  • A gamer lost $32,000 while fundraising for cancer treatment after downloading the game.
  • The malicious game targeted 261 Steam accounts, siphoning off $150,000 in total.
  • Security groups reported even more victims, urging immediate password changes.
  • Similar malware incidents on Steam highlight the need for cautious gaming.
